Prologue

Zalphon's army of the dead have become a serious problem in the Black Marsh. In the Obsidian Tower, he discovered a suit of Ancient Daedric Armor that belonged to his great grandfather, Korvinus Broodikus. After imbueing it with the souls of many argonians, it has been repaired. His power in the dark arts has grown since the Battle of Lunarscar. As has his swordsmanship. He is a lich. His flesh is rotted, his eyes are sunken and pallid, but he is extremely powerful physically. Every day he waits. For his old friend, Quick-Strike...

Quick-Strike has been a wanderer since the Battle of Lunarscar. J'skooma dilligently following him. They've travelled across Tamriel, searching. For Zalphon. Over the long years, the Argonian Assassin has become a pious believer of the Nine. But, he has become bitter and harsh, due to the betrayal Zalphon caused.

J'skooma has travelled with Quick-Strike since Lunarscar. They both wandered the lands, seeking their old friend. He had finally found his place in Nirn. To save Tamriel from the darkest thing they'd ever face. The Shadow Knight...

A new hero arises. Tanys Shadowblade. A Crusader using his powers to defend Tamriel. He is a young Dunmer seeking to protect Nirn from the Shadow Knight. He is young and niave. But he seeks to join a couple of heroes who supposedly fought Zalphon in a Nord Village in Skyrim. The question is, will Shadowblade live up to his family's expectations? His entire family had been Dark Brotherhood Assassins or Devout Followers of Mannimarco or Clerics of Mehrunes Dagon. Will he live up to his family name? Or will he create a new one? Only time will tell...

Tamriel is in grave danger... Will the heroes pick up their weapons one more time? Will they be brave enough to face the wicked soon-to-be god? The fate of Tamriel is in their hands, hopefully they save it...
